Tracking sets of Keypoints by Person
I suggest to try the top down approach with the https://openmmlab.com/ open source package. The openmmlab provides multiple algorithms, datasets and pretrained models for various computer vision tasks. Start with mmpose video demo that integrates detection and pose estimation. You can add later tracking with https://github.com/open-mmlab/mmtracking to track the poses in time.

Master thesis on autonomous vehicles (cybersecurity aspect)
You create and test the attacks on datasets like Kitti, NuScenes, and many others. Basically you try to manipulate the input to a certain detection pipeline for example (You can find a lot of LiDAR and camera based detection pipelines here: https://github.com/open-mmlab/mmdetection3d and here https://github.com/open-mmlab/mmdetection). You try to manipulate the input so that it deceives the car to do what you need without having control to the car itself.
